Guyana: Dr Irfaan ALi, President of the Co-operative Republic of Guyana and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ces, attended the Guyana Defence Force’s (GDF) Medal Presentation Parade at Base Camp Ayanganna yesterday (March 30, 2022).

Commander-in-chief of the Armed Forces also presented several soldiers, including officers with medals at the Guyana Defence Force’s Medal Presentation Parade at Base Camp Ayanganna.

He also address the event and encouraged the soldiers and outlined the significance of the responsibility towards the country and its safety and security. President Ali further presented sixteen GDF ranks with the Military Efficiency Medal (MEM). 

The cadres have been awarded by the President of Guyana for their extremely great job in the field and continuous service with passion and a sense of responsibility. 

Prez Ali awarded cadres of Armed Forces of Guyana with different ranks

Guyana President has awarded the sixteen GDF rank with Military Efficacies Medal (MEM) and to ranks who would have completed ten years of continuous service with good conduct.

The nomination has been conducted by the Chief of Staff Brigadier Godfrey Bess for the wards and the above-mentioned recommendations have been declared by the Medal Awards Committee (MAC), the awardees were approved by the Chief of Staff Brigadier Godfrey Bess.

Further, the President of Guyana has awarded the ten ranks with the Border defence Medal. These category medals have been awarded to ranks who would have had cumulative service on a border location in excess of one year.

The Office of the President stated that to get ranked in the awards of the Armed Forces in Guyana, as with the Military Efficiency Medal (MEM), recommendations by the MAC and approval by the Chief of Staff were also required.

It has also informed that around Seventy-four ranks, including seven officers, will receive the Border Defence Medal. 

Prez Ali awarded cadres of Armed Forces of Guyana with different ranks

On the other hand, eighty-one ranks, twenty-four of whom are officers, have met the requirement for the MEM.

President Ali was joined by Minister of Home Affairs, Robeson Benn; Chief of Staff of the GDF, Brigadier Godfrey Bess; Police Commissioner (ag), Clifton Hicken and other government officials.
